copyright vs. Altcoins: Understanding the Differences

Navigating more info the dynamic world of copyright can be a daunting task, especially with the sheer volume of options available. At the heart of this landscape lie two primary categories: Bitcoin and altcoins. Bitcoin, often hailed as the original copyright, stands apart from its counterparts due to its first-mover advantage, established infrastructure, and unwavering market dominance. Altcoins, on the other hand, represent a diverse range of cryptocurrencies that have sprung up in the wake of Bitcoin, each seeking to improve upon its predecessor or address particular use cases.

  • Moreover, altcoins often venture with novel features to enhance efficiency. For instance, some altcoins leverage proof-of-stake as an alternative to Bitcoin's mining process system.
  • Ultimately, the choice between Bitcoin and altcoins depends on individual usage goals, risk tolerance, and understanding of each copyright's unique features.

DeFi: A New Frontier

Decentralized Finance, or the decentralized finance revolution, is rapidly gaining traction of finance. By leveraging blockchain technology, DeFi provides individuals with unprecedented control over their assets.

This move drives a more inclusive financial system where participants are no longer subject to the restrictions of traditional institutions.

DeFi platforms are leveling the playing field to a broad spectrum of financial services, such as lending, borrowing, trading, and even coverage, all without the need for intermediaries. This unprecedented control has the potential to reshape the future of finance.
